The Product Liability Advisory Council (PLAC) is a nonprofit of more than 100 product manufacturers and 350 defense counsels formed in 1983 to address product liability and complex litigation. PLAC wanted to offer “large association” services despite a very small staff, requiring a solution with strong power, usability, supportability and web integration — and an implementation that would deliver visible value on time and on budget.

Using iMIS (implemented with ASI and an Authorized iMIS Solution Provider), PLAC added web-based member services—searchable directory and self-service profile editing, online conference registration and payments, file-sharing communities—and enhanced reporting to track recruiting and target prospects. The system was completed on time and on budget, enabled PLAC to operate without in-house IT, and improved record-keeping and member-service efficiency.
